We're looking for Full Stack Engineers who are hardworking, inquisitive, and responsible individuals to help deliver the best digital web experience to our customers to join Fidelity Health & Benefits Accounts Debit Card Insourcing team within Workplace Investing (WI). The ideal candidate is deeply entrenched in front and middle tier development, with a passion for using tools and frameworks to guide the development of stable, robust, and resilient apps that best serve our customer base.
The Value You Deliver
Partnering with experience platform squads for engineering standards, standard methodologies, and tooling, to ensure maintainability and stability of the codebase.
Collaborating with other team members and collaborators to analyse and solve problems.
Supporting a cloud-first world through upskilling and augmenting squads with solid knowledge of cloud technologies.
Staying ahead of the curve by aligning architecture, user experience, and security with chapters and COEs, your skills will be applied to our aligned initiatives providing you the opportunity to quickly make a difference in our customers’ lives!
The Skills That Are Key To This Role
Strong technical background on crafting and developing enterprise digital applications with MVC design pattern, micro front-end and open micro service architectures.
Solid knowledge of 12-factor methodology, containerization and cloud technologies.
Angular & TypeScript: Skilled in building responsive UIs using Angular and TypeScript
Java & Spring Boot: Good experience in developing middle-tier services and integrating with REST APIs
API Integration: Collaborates with record keeping teams to define and consume RESTful APIs
Testing: Experience in quality-first, testable solutions using TDD and automation
CI/CD & DevOps: Build robust CI/CD and shift left practices
Cloud Exposure: Experience with deploying apps in AWS/Azure platforms
Secure Coding: Follows secure coding practices and guidelines
Problem Solving: Breaks down tasks and contributes to feature development
Communication: Collaborates effectively within the team and with leads
How Your Work Impacts The Organization
As a Full Stack Engineer within the Fidelity Healthcare Technology Team, you will be engaged in a highly dynamic group that responds to customer and business needs. Our team builds outstanding experiences for Fidelity Healthcare customers. We focus on crafting rich and compelling experiences using the best Design guidelines by way of robust tooling to provide healthcare benefits to our customers. We work in a collaborative, fast paced environment and are committed to advancing experience to the delight of our customers.
The Expertise We’re Looking For
2-4 years of experience in designing and implementing APIs in the cloud native environment across Cloud platforms
Bachelor’s degree of Computer Science or other related field.
Experience in building highly resilient/scalable APIs for high compute processing apps and leverage DevAssist tools as part of daily development
Solid experience with Java, Spring framework and/or the Open-Source stack technologies
Location: Chennai
Shift timings: 11:00 am - 8:00pm
